Ingredients

  • 1 lb boneless chicken thighs, cut into bite-sized pieces
  • 4 cups dashi stock or chicken broth
  • 2 tablespoons soy sauce
  • 2 tablespoons mirin
  • 1 tablespoon sake
  • 1 tablespoon sesame oil
  • 1 cup mushrooms, sliced (shiitake or enoki)
  • 2 cups napa cabbage, chopped
  • 1 cup carrots, sliced
  • 2 green onions, chopped
  • 1 block tofu, cubed
  • Optional: cooked udon noodles for serving

Instructions

  1. Prepare the Broth: In a large pot, combine dashi stock, soy sauce, mirin, and sake. Bring to a simmer over medium heat.
  2. Add Chicken: Once the broth is simmering, add the chicken pieces and cook until they are no longer pink, about 5-7 minutes.
  3. Incorporate Vegetables: Add mushrooms, napa cabbage, carrots, and tofu to the pot. Allow them to cook for an additional 5-10 minutes until the vegetables are tender.
  4. Serve: Ladle the hot pot into bowls and top with chopped green onions. If desired, serve over cooked udon noodles for a heartier meal.

Cook and Prep Times

  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 20 minutes
  • Total Time: 35 minutes
